Tender description

The National Sustainable Mobility Policy sets out a strategic framework for active travel and public transport journeys to help Ireland meet its climate obligations. In support of this policy and in line with the objectives of Carlow County Development Plan 2022-2028 and Carlow County Council Climate Change Adaptation Strategy 2019-2024, Carlow County Council are keen to encourage greater use of active travel modes. To this end, Carlow County Council is inviting proposals from suitably experienced operators for the provision of an e bike share scheme in and around Carlow Town and Environs.
